Hi-Z
An abbreviation of the term High Impedance (Impedance of 5000 or more ohms).

Three or more musical pitches sung or played together.
CPU
Abbreviation of Central Processing Unit (The main "brain" chip of a computer or the main housing of a computer that contains the "brain" chip).

A European term for the signal sent to the stage monitors in a live performance.
Cue
1) The signal fed back to the musicians through headphones.
2) To set the tape or disc so that the intended selection will immediately play when the tape machine or player is started.
3) A location point entered into a computer controlling the playback or recording of a track or tape.
4) In MCI brand tape machines, a term meaning the same thing as Sync Playback (where the record head is used as a playback head for those tracks already recorded).
Echo Send Control
A control to send the signal from the input module to the echo chamber or effects device via the echo buss.
Equal Loudness Contours
A drawing of several curves showing how loud the tones of different frequencies would have to be played for a person to say they were of equal loudness.
